Back at E3 2016 Microsoft unveiled the new Xbox One controller alongside the ability for fans to create their very own in the Xbox Design Lab.
Currently the Design Lab function is only available in the U.S., Canada, and Puerto Rico, but Microsoft is looking to expand in 2017.
The Design Lab is still open for those who want to create their own controller, including an engraving of up to 16 characters, starting at $79.99.
Each controller is hand made to the order, and there are eight million variations available.
